hebrew #3798 - כְּתִלִישׁ Kithlish
Strong's Exhaustive Concordance Kithlish From kothel and 'iysh; wall of a man; Kithlish, a place in Palestine -- Kithlish. see HEBREW kothel see HEBREW 'iysh Englishman's Concordance Kithlish=“man’s wall” 1) one of the lowland towns of Judah Part of Speech: noun proper locative A Related Word by BDB/Strong’s Number: from H3796 and H376 Brown-Driver-Briggsכִּתְלִישׁproper name, of a locationa city of JudahJoshua 15:40, site unknown; ᵐ5BΜααχως A Ξαθλως, ᵐ5LΚαθαλεις.
